Polycab’s FY-23 Revenue Corsses 14,000 Cr, Wire & Cable Revenue Jumps 18.38%

Polycab India Ltd. (PIL) [NSE: POLYCAB, BOM: 542652], one of the leading names in the Indian wire & cable industry, has announced its financial results for the quarter and the year ended 31st March 2023.
Polycab India’s Standalone Financial Figures
For the quarter ended 31st March 2023, Polycab reported a standalone revenue of Rs. 4,287.41 crore, and a corresponding Profit After Tax (PAT) of Rs. 432.84 crore. Further, the company’s Earnings Per Share (EPS) on a standalone basis was Rs. 28.91 during Q4 of FY-23.
Considering the entire financial year, this wire & cable giant amassed a top-line of Rs. 13,911.57 crore and a corresponding bottom-line of Rs. 1,271.59 crore in FY-23. Further, EPS for fiscal FY23 stood at Rs. 84.98 on a standalone basis.

YoY Comparison of Polycab’s Financials: Q4 FY-22 vs. Q4 FY-23 & FY-22 vs. FY-23

On a Year-over-Year (YoY) basis, Polycab’s Q4 revenue grew slightly by 8.91% to Rs. 4,323.68 crore in FY-23 from Rs. 3,969.98 crore during FY-22.
PAT of the company for Q4 FY23 showed an encouraging growth of 31.68% to Rs. 428.42 crore from Rs. 325.34 crore clocked during Q4 of FY-22.
Further, Polycab’s EPS grew to Rs. 28.37 in Q4 of FY-23 from Rs. 21.57 in Q4 of the year ended 31st March 2022.
Polycab’s top line for the year ended 31st March 2023 was Rs. 14,107.78 crore, which reflects a substantial growth of 15.60% from the company’s Rs. 12,203.76 crore revenue earned in FY-22.
Moreover, the company reported Rs. 1,282.25 crore as its profit for the 2022-23 financial year against a bottom line of Rs. 917.28 crore earned during FY-22; an increase of almost 40%.

Polycab’s consolidated EPS for FY-23 stood at Rs. 84.87, exhibiting a 39.43% jump from its EPS of Rs. 60.87 during FY-22.
QoQ Comparison of Polycab’s Financials: Q3 FY-23 vs. Q4 FY-23
Polycab’s revenue soared 16.38% on a Quarter-over-Quarter (QoQ) basis from Rs. 3,715.18 crore which was reported by the company for Q3 of FY-23.
PAT followed the same trend, growing by 18.73% from Rs. 360.83 crore earned during the quarter ended 31st December 2022.
Polycab’s EPS increased by 18.75% QoQ from Rs. 23.89 in Q3 of the 2022-23 fiscal.
Polycab’s Segment-Wise Consolidated Revenue
Revenue in Rs. Cr.

Wires & Cables: Polycab is chiefly a wire and cable manufacturer since this segment contributes the maximum to the company’s revenue. In FY-23, this segment brought in 90.57% of PIL’s total revenue.
For the quarter ended 31st March 2023, the company clocked Rs. 4,078.29 crore from its wire and cable business, which is YoY 15.21% higher than the Q4 revenue of Rs. 3,540.02 crore from this segment reported in FY-22.
Considering the entire year, PIL’s revenue from this segment grew noticeably by 18.38% to Rs. 12,777.50 crore in FY-23 from Rs. 10,793.81 crore in FY-22. It is interesting to note that Polycab’s FY-23 revenue from wires and cables is higher than its total revenue for FY-22.
Fast Moving Electrical Goods (FMEG): Polycab’s FMEG business brought in Rs. 305.22 crore as revenue during the quarter ended 31st March 2023, and Rs. 1,260.74 crore during the entire FY-23.
This reflects a YoY drop of 19.51% in the company’s Q4 FMEG revenue from Rs. 379.22 crore earned in FY-22. Further, Polycab’s revenue from this segment dropped QoQ by 10.76% from Rs. 342.01 crore earned in Q3 of FY-23.
Considering the full year, Ploycab’s FMEG revenue for FY-23 was almost the same as in FY-22, recording a meagre rise of 0.51%. For FY-22, Polycab’s FMEG revenue was Rs. 1,254.38 crore.
Other: This segment comprises Polycab India’s EPC business.
For Q4 FY23, PIL’s revenue from this segment was Rs. 133.78 crore, which reflects a YoY jump of 28.08% from Rs. 104.45 crore segmental revenue for Q4 of FY-22. On a QoQ basis, the company’s EPC revenue increased slightly by 6.17% from its Q3 revenue of Rs. 126.01 crore in FY-23.
Considering the entire year, Polycab reported a top line of Rs. 464.71 crore in FY-23 from this segment, soaring remarkably by 25.54% from its FY-22 EPC revenue of Rs. 370.18 crore.
Polycab’s Insight on its Financial Performance

Commenting on the company’s financial performance, Mr. Inder T. Jaisinghani, Polycab’s Chairman and Managing Director, said, “FY23 was a remarkable year for the Company, as we surpassed revenues of ₹140 Bn and profitability threshold of ₹10 Bn, to record highest ever revenues and PAT in the history of the Company. With robust demand on the anvil, we are confident of exhibiting continued strong growth in the near-to-mid term as well”.
In its press release dated 12th May 2023, the company elaborated that the YoY growth in wire and cable revenue from FY-22 to FY-23 has been due to a healthy increase in volume. Further, considering the entire 2022-23 fiscal, exports contributed to 9.8% of the company’s total revenue.
Polycab explained that its performance in the FMEG segment was impacted by the reorganization of its distribution channels keeping in mind its long-term growth. “With the distribution realignment completed, the Company is confident of improving top-line and bottom-line from FY24”, the release stated.
About Polycab India Limited: Polycab India Limited was established in 1996. The company’s wire and cable portfolio includes power cables, control cables, instrumentation cables, solar cables, building wires, flexible cables, flexible/single multi-core cables, communication cables, and others including welding cables, submersible flat and round cables, rubber cables, overhead conductors, railway signaling cables, specialty cables and green wires.
